About this item

Highlights

  • Almighty Audio - Experience ultimate clarity and sound clarity with Premium High Fidelity Drivers. Fully customize the sound experience with the Sonar Software by using a first-in-gaming Pro-grade Parametric EQ.
  • 360° Spatial Audio - Immersive surround sound transports you to the gaming world, letting you hear every critical step, reload, or vocal cue to give you an advantage. *Fully compatible with Microsoft Spatial Sound for Xbox /Tempest 3D Audio for PS5
  • Active Noise Cancellation - Immerse yourself in your virtual world as a specialized 4-mic hybrid system designed for gaming tunes out ambient noise. Use Transparency Mode with variable levels to adapt to any situation.
  • Infinity Power System - Hot-swap between using one battery while charging the other to keep your headset going and going and going.
  • Multi-System Connect - Twin USB ports let you connect your Xbox and PC, Mac, PlayStation, or Switch, and swap between them with the press of a button.
  • Dual Audio Streams - Mix two audio connections at the same time, letting you chat with friends while gaming. Play with lag-free 2.4GHz while using Bluetooth simultaneously for calls, Discord, music, and podcasts.
  • AI Powered Noise-Cancelling Mic -The ClearCast Gen 2 mic silences background noise to give you crystal clear comms, backed by Sonar Software's powerful AI algorithms. The mic also fully retracts into the earcup for a sleeker look.

Description

The Arctis Nova Pro Wireless for Xbox raises the bar for audio headsets with the Nova Pro Acoustic System, immersive 360° Spatial Audio, Sonar Software, Active Noise Cancellation, and a dual-battery system.

Q: Could you please explain the difference between this version and the PC version? I want to use it for PC FPS gaming, but I noticed from my online search that it doesn't seem to support Sonar or SteelS

submitted by A - 4 months ago
  • A: Hi A, thanks for reaching out about SteelSeries Arctis Nova Pro Wireless Gaming Headset for Xbox. The SteelSeries Arctis Nova Pro Wireless for Xbox is specifically designed for use with Xbox consoles, while the PC version is optimized for use with PCs. Here's a breakdown of the key differences: Software Compatibility: Xbox Version: Limited Software Support: Primarily focuses on Xbox features and may have limited compatibility with SteelSeries GG or Sonar software on PC. May not support all features: Some features like advanced EQ settings or in-depth audio customization might be limited or unavailable when used with the Xbox version on PC. PC Version: Full Software Support: Designed for full compatibility with SteelSeries GG and Sonar software on PC, offering extensive customization options, EQ profiles, and advanced audio features. Connectivity: Xbox Version: Optimized for seamless connection with Xbox consoles, potentially with dedicated features for Xbox ecosystems. PC Version: Prioritizes connectivity and compatibility with various PC components and peripherals.
